LEXMOTO LXR 125 FAQ
Is the LEXMOTO LXR 125 reliable?
The LEXMOTO LXR 125 is less reliable than average for its class: 61.1% of its 1,041 MOT tests (2005–2025) passed first time, against a class average of 73.4%. That ranks it #5178 of 5426 models.
What does a LXR 125 fail its MOT on most?
lamps and reflectors — 38% of all defects recorded against failed LXR 125 tests.
